    Just brought it home from EB. I bought the whole game, so EA should be happy Graphics are much improved from the original, or at least they seem to be. Haven't played it much yet, tried a Custom battle with Mongol units (I was Mongols) and won

    The ability to buy armor and weapons upgrades will take some getting used to, need to test out how effective they can be I guess. I can see alot of time being spent in the Custom battle mode until we can figure all this stuff out.

    I noticed in the again paper thin manual (man that burnes my butt to think we'll have to wait for a new "European manual" ) that depleted units can be combined, with the excess remaining units staying in their original unit while the topped-up unit is full strength. I hope this is true as I think we all would like to stop doing the addition when we combine units LOL
